I don't think "Dragon" will have a tower either. If their system goes to plan, the Dragon will have eight 120,000 lb thrust side-mounted liquid-fueled engines for abort. As an added bonus they can be used for powered descent in the event of a parachute failure, or as the primary means of deceleration with the parachutes available in the event of an engine failure.
